How much do electronics engineer part time jobs pay per year?

As of Jul 17, 2026, the average yearly pay for electronics engineer part time in Texas is $82,820.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$55,400.00 and $102,000.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Electronics Engineer Part Time position, and why are they important?

Success as a part-time Electronics Engineer requires a solid background in electronic circuit design, troubleshooting, and relevant engineering principles, typically supported by a degree in electrical or electronics engineering. Familiarity with CAD software, PCB design tools, and commonly used industry certifications such as IPC or IEEE membership is often expected. Strong problem-solving abilities, effective time management, and clear communication are key soft skills that set candidates apart in this role. These qualifications ensure the engineer can efficiently contribute to projects, collaborate with multidisciplinary teams, and maintain high standards even within limited working hours.

What are the typical responsibilities and projects for part-time Electronics Engineers?

Part-time Electronics Engineers often engage in specific project work, such as circuit design, prototype development, or testing electronic systems, and may be assigned to support ongoing engineering initiatives. Daily tasks can include troubleshooting hardware, updating technical documentation, or collaborating with full-time engineers and cross-functional teams to meet project milestones. The work structure is typically flexible, allowing engineers to focus on deliverables suited to their availability while still contributing meaningfully to team goals. Part-timers may also be involved in design reviews, product support, or short-term R&D projects. This setup offers valuable exposure to different phases of the engineering process while supporting a work-life balance.

What is an Electronics Engineer Part Time job?

A part-time Electronics Engineer designs, develops, and tests electronic systems and components while working fewer hours than a full-time role. Responsibilities may include circuit design, troubleshooting, and collaborating on projects involving hardware and software integration. These roles are often found in industries like consumer electronics, telecommunications, and automotive. Part-time positions may be ideal for students, freelancers, or professionals seeking work-life balance. The job requirements typically include an engineering degree and experience with electronic circuits and systems.

Job Description:
Responsible for development of product requirements, feature requirements, systems and performance analysis, conduct deep-dive customer sessions on 4G/5G Call processing related features and air interface technologies. Analyze the customer requirements, converting them into system requirements and capturing detailed design for the development team for all Samsung product features. Responsible for technical discussions on Samsung products/scheduler related features with several customer vertical organizations including 4G/5G RAN Development groups and RAN performance groups. Author technical proposals, technical research and white papers, design documents, Operator network design, RFI/RFP, and Patent filings. Aid in product & feature performance analysis, evaluation of new product & SW releases and third-party product evaluation to build product synergies. Provides expert technical support in the pre-sales process and creates compelling technical and commercial solutions in order to help achieve the assigned sales goals and business objectives. Translate and communicate complex technical design considerations between the Samsung sales team and carriers' network business. Works closely with various support organizations, logistics, and cross-functional teams from SEA and Samsung HQ to achieve successful new product rollouts and developments. Accountable for leading field integration testing efforts (FFA/FIT/FSA) of all 4G/5G key features with customers, including test plan development, reviewing test plan with customers, driving cross-functional teams to execution, review of test results, issue identification, analysis and quality proofing until software acceptance is achieved. Responsible for Tier3 support, analyzing and troubleshooting scheduler related issues reported from customer labs, field sites and production network. Review and provide recommendations to improve LTE RAN network performance by evaluating and trending key KPIs, performing trials and providing optimization guidelines.
Minimum Education & Experience Requirements:
Master's degree in Computer Science, Information Technology, Telecommunications, Electrical and Computer Engineering, Electronics and Communication Engineering, a related field, or a foreign equivalent plus 2 years of post-baccalaureate experience in job offered or engineering/networks related job titles.
Applicants must possess at least 2 years of experience in the following: (1) 4G/5G Call Processing experience including RRC, S1-MME, S1-U and X2 protocols; (2) Hybrid Beamforming, Massive MIMO, New Waveforms, LTE-NR interworking & co-existence; (3) 3GPP RAN product architecture, design & implementation; (4) system engineering activities including feature requirements identification, feature description documentation, parameter optimization, performance analysis, test strategy creation, problem troubleshooting; (5) RF antenna technologies & network optimizations; (6) protocol analyzers and simulation environments including MATLAB and test tools such as XCAL, QXDM, Wireshark, Channel Emulator, Spectrum Analyzers; and (7) EN-DC network architecture, 5G Numerologies. 5-10% domestic travel for client/team meetings as required.
